The Irish countryside is known for its lush green landscape and abundance of fresh, local produce. From potatoes to dairy, Ireland is home to a wide range of delicious ingredients that have been used in traditional Irish recipes for centuries.

Irish produce is renowned for its high quality, our climate and soil are ideal for producing some of the finest ingredients in the world.

Community & Employee Ownership
The framework for Eato Ireland is based on a Community and Employee Ownership Model, the mission over a 10 year development period is whereby the Community and Employees will become the majority Shareholders of their County.
